Choosing an Experienced Car Accident Lawyer
The aftermath of a car accident can be overwhelming for victims. They are often confronted with severe injuries and costly property damage.
An experienced attorney can help them recover the compensation they deserve. They will ensure that the liable parties are identified properly and ensure that they are held accountable.
Experience
A seasoned lawyer for car accidents can assist you in obtaining the compensation you are entitled to for your injuries and damage. They can handle the complex legal procedure and ensure that all deadlines are completed. They can also negotiate and litigate with insurance companies when required. This allows you to concentrate on your recovery and return to normal life sooner.
An attorney can help you determine your total losses which include past, current, and future medical expenses, lost wages, damage to property, as well as pain and discomfort. This isn't an easy task by yourself, and the experience and expertise of an attorney can make a difference in the amount of money you receive as a settlement.
When selecting a firm choose one that has an impressive track record of success and a solid reputation. Ask your family, friends, and coworkers for recommendations, and also read reviews from clients online. Fees
Hiring a car accident attorney can be an expensive proposition for many victims. The assistance of a lawyer with experience are typically worth the cost. They can help navigate the maze of personal injury cases and increase the likelihood of a higher settlement or court decision, and ensure that all damages are fully compensated. In addition, they can offer peace of mind and help through a challenging time.
It is important to take into account the attorney's experience, reputation and communication abilities. Also, take into consideration the fee structure. It is crucial to select an attorney that is familiar with the laws in your state and the way insurance companies work in the event of car accidents. A reputable lawyer for car accidents must be able to explain complicated legal concepts in a way that is easy for clients to comprehend and answer any queries promptly.
A car accident lawyer will usually charge a contingent fee. This means that they will take a portion of the settlement you receive. This is a standard practice in many states. However, some lawyers might charge an hourly rate or a flat fee instead of a contingency fee. It is best to discuss fees with potential attorneys during the initial meeting.
Be aware of other costs that could be associated with your case. This could include filing fees as well as court filing fees and other expenses like medical experts or investigators. A reputable car accident lawyer should be able to explain these costs to you and obtain your approval prior to committing any additional costs.
